About HCTA

Humanity Common Thread Association (HCTA) was founded in the fall of 2025 after five HR professionals connected during a regional HR roundtable discussion centered around the growing challenges facing today’s workforce. What began as an open conversation about burnout, compliance pressures, technology overload, employee wellbeing, and the need for stronger professional support quickly evolved into a shared realization: HR professionals needed more than networking events — they needed a true community.

The founding members recognized that many professionals across HR, payroll, benefits, operations, and leadership roles were searching for a space where they could openly collaborate, continue learning, seek guidance, and support one another without judgment. From those conversations, HCTA was created with the belief that behind every policy, process, and workplace initiative is a human being deserving of empathy, connection, and support.

Built around the vision of creating a safe space for continued education, problem-solving, wrap-around support, and humanity, HCTA exists to bring professionals together through meaningful relationships and practical resources. The association’s mission is to empower HR professionals through a community that offers opportunities for professional development, mental wellness, physical health, and technological integration — helping members thrive both personally and professionally.

Today, HCTA continues to grow as a collaborative network focused on strengthening workplaces, supporting people, and creating a stronger, more connected HR community through shared experiences, education, innovation, and humanity.
